Colleen attended the Community Development Council Durham's Annual General Meeting and 40th Anniversary Celebration on April 15, 2010.  Prior to election to Regional Council, Colleen was the Executive Director of CDCD, which is a non profit organ- ization that provides child nutrition programs, housing help, immigrant settlement support and performs social research functions for the Durham community. 

Sarah McDonald former President of CDCD (then named Social Development Council Ajax-Pickering) and retired Principal Durham District Board of Education was one of the honoured guests at the celebration.

 
Pictured with Colleen is the current Executive Director, Tracey Vaughan.

 

 Ajax 2010 Volunteer Awards, April 22, 2010

Colleen presented awards at the Ajax 2010 Volunteer Awards on April 22,
2010 at the Ajax Community Centre.   Outstanding community volunteers
are acknowledged at the annual event. Award winners are selected by a
committee  under specific categories.

Colleen is pictured presenting the Diversity and Community Award to the
Women's Multicultural Resource and Counselling Centre of Durham Region.
(WMRCC).  WMRCC provide support to immigrant and refugee women aimed atbbuilding life skills, reducing isolation and increasing self worth.
From 2007 to 2008 WMRCC also provided diversity training to over 70
community organizations in Durham.  Executive Director Esther Enylou
accepted the award on behalf of the Board, staff and volunteers of
WMRCC.

 

EIMG_1410.jpg Colleen presented the Environmental Award to the Ajax Trails Committee who have provided advice, on the development of new trails as well as marketing and promotion of the trails.  They participate in a number of town events, and organize Ajax Trailfest which includes "Ride Ajax with the Mayor."  The Committee provides a  number of guided walks Throughout the year and have been instrumental in Ajax, with its more than 80 kilometres of trails becoming the trail capital of Durham .  Colleen is shown with Deb Steer, who accepted the award on behalf of the Ajax Trails Committee.
